Me 262A-1, WrN. 111918 of Stab.I/Jg 7 in May 1945. This aircraft was photographed after being abandoned in it's hangar at the Brandenburg-Briest airfield. This aircraft was finished in a high demarcation camouflage pattern of RLM 81 and 82 over 76 with mottles of 81 and 82. The single chevron indicates the aircraft was probably the personal mount of the Gruppe adjutant.
